The Infrastructure Bet Behind the Model War
🌟 Today's Industry Insight
Today's AI landscape reveals a critical divergence: the public is captivated by the benchmark war between GPT-5.6, Claude Opus 4.8, and MiniMax M3, while the foundational capital is decisively shifting to the infrastructure needed to sustain and monetize these models. The headline $35 billion platform for Anthropic's compute, backed by Apollo and Blackstone, is not merely a funding round; it is a market signal that the era of "compute as a service" is evolving into "compute as a dedicated utility." This move stratifies the competitive landscape. Frontier labs are no longer just software entities; they are now tethered to massive, bespoke physical infrastructure, raising the barrier for new entrants and deepening the dependency on a handful of hyperscalers and infrastructure partners.
The real second-order signal here is the bifurcation of the AI economy. On one side, you have the Model & Agent Layer (the three-way battle, Claude Fable's safety focus), where differentiation is increasingly about nuanced intelligence and alignment. On the other, the Infrastructure & Integration Layer (Broadcom/Anthropic, WeChat/Dewu) where the race is for compute at scale and embedding AI into existing trust networks. The venture is not just in training a smarter model; it is in owning the pipes and the gateways. This explains why a "super app" ambition from OpenAI is not a distraction but a logical play for control over an end-to-end user stack, from foundation model to final application. The key question for the next quarter is whether the infrastructure bet will create a durable moat or lead to over-capacity and a brutal price war that favors only the largest platform operators.

🚀 Anthropic Secures $35B for Dedicated AI Compute Platform
- What happened: Broadcom, Apollo, and Blackstone are creating a $35 billion platform specifically to provide Anthropic with approximately 20 gigawatts of computing power.
- Why it matters: This decouples scaling from cloud provider queues and sets a precedent for "compute-of-its-own" for leading AI labs. It creates a new asset class for institutional investors and signals that compute is now as strategic as oil reserves.
- Variables to watch: 1) Will other labs like OpenAI or Google DeepMind secure similar bespoke infrastructure deals? 2) How does this affect the pricing and availability of compute from AWS, Azure, and GCP for smaller companies? 3) Does this make Anthropic's long-term cost structure fundamentally more predictable than its rivals?

🚨 WeChat & Dewu Integration Signals AI Agent as Utility
- What happened: The luxury authentication service Dewu integrated its entire operational process into WeChat’s AI Agent, moving beyond chatbots to full transactional fulfillment.
- Why it matters: This is a concrete example of AI agents graduating from pilots to core business functions. It validates the "super app" model in the West's imagination and shows how embedded AI can lock in users within a closed ecosystem.
- Variables to watch: 1) Which Western "super apps" (e.g., Uber, DoorDash) will attempt this depth of integration first? 2) Does this accelerate the decline of traditional app stores and mobile web? 3) How do antitrust regulators view such deep, agent-driven vendor lock-in?
